AI Software Engineer
DeepLearning.AI, founded by AI visionary Andrew Ng, is seeking a skilled AI Software Engineer to build scalable, secure, and innovative learning experiences that empower global AI builders. In this role, you’ll combine strong software engineering fundamentals with creativity and a passion for user-focused design. You’ll work on cutting-edge products-from LMS integrations and enterprise dashboards to AI-powered user interfaces-leveraging the latest GenAI tools and frameworks. You’ll collaborate closely with the Product team to scope, prototype, and deliver impactful features that enhance user engagement and drive measurable business results. This position offers the opportunity to work on high-impact projects in a mission-driven company that’s shaping the future of AI education. If you’re a strong coder with a solid CS foundation, familiarity with modern web frameworks, and enthusiasm for AI-driven innovation, this is your chance to make a meaningful difference at the forefront of artificial intelligence.
Application accepted until position is filled
Requirements
1. Bachelor’s degree in Computer Science or related technical field.
2. Minimum 3 years of software development experience with full project lifecycle delivery.
3. Strong understanding of CS fundamentals, data structures, and algorithms.
4. Proficiency with React.js, Next.js, TypeScript, Tailwind, and related frontend tools.
5. Backend experience with Python, Django, FastAPI, and SQL.
6. Familiarity with APIs (REST, GraphQL), Docker, and microservice architectures.
7. Experience in Test-Driven Development (TDD) and secure coding practices.
8. Familiarity with LLM APIs, agentic workflows, or ML frameworks is a plus.
9. Excellent communication and teamwork skills.
Benefits
1. Competitive compensation and equity opportunities.
2. Comprehensive health, dental, and vision coverage.
3. 401(k) plan and monthly education stipend.
4. Flexible PTO and hybrid work flexibility.
5. Opportunity to collaborate globally with an expert, mission-driven team.
6. Creative and inclusive work culture grounded in authenticity and excellence.
The application process will continue on the employer's website.
Location
Mountain View, CA